Lady is a Supporter Trainer card from the Shiny Vault subset of Hidden Fates, an English Sun and Moon era release known for its shiny Pokemon and tightly curated checklist. As a Supporter, only one can be played per turn, so cards like Lady carried real weight in deck building during their period.
The SV86/SV94 number places this card firmly inside the Shiny Vault, the SV lettered run that sits alongside the main Hidden Fates set. Collectors often pursue the Shiny Vault as a complete subset, and the tags confirm a Shiny Holo Rare finish, giving the card its shiny styling and holographic surface.
Trainer cards from the Shiny Vault are popular targets for anyone working towards a full SV run, and Hidden Fates continues to draw interest for its focused design and shiny treatment across both Pokemon and support cards.
Condition and authenticity
This card meets Monster Mart's Mint condition standard:
- Corners: No visible fraying or whitening
- Edges: Smooth and clean, no silvering
- Surface: Free of scratches, dents, creases or smudges
- Centering: Within 60/40 front limit
Every card is authenticated and thoroughly inspected by Monster Mart, and ships tracked from Brisbane in protective sleeves and rigid holders.
